Coder Social home page Coder Social logo

asm-x86's Introduction

x86 汇编语言:从实模式到保护模式

“配书源码和工具”文件夹包含了本书第5、6、7、8、9、11、12、13、14、15、16和17章的完整源代码,可以用NASMIDE程序编译,然后写入虚拟硬盘,在VirtualBox和Bochs中运行并观察结果;

“相关教程”文件夹包含了VirtualBox和Bochs软件的下载、安装和配置教程,建议认真阅读,包括那些已经会使用这两款软件的人。原因是,要在本书中使用这两款软件,需要一些特别的配置过程;

“原稿第10章内容”文件夹包含的是原稿第10章,这一章在实体书中删掉了。这一章讲的是如何用汇编语言来控制老的Sound Blaster 16声卡播放声音。

谢谢使用!

作者,2012年11月16日19点22分。

2020年3月11日补充说明:

  1. 应部分网友请求,“配书源码和工具”文件夹里增加一个新的虚拟硬盘写入工具fixvhdw2.exe,代替原先的fixvhdwr.exe。
  2. 有部分读者对通过端口的硬盘读写感兴趣,为此在“相关教程”目录下添加一个AT设备数据包规范:AT_Attachment_with_Packet_Interface_-_7_Volume_1.pdf
  3. 在“相关教程“目录下添加了有关实时时钟的参考文档:Periodic Interrupts with the Real Time Clock

作者博客:http://www.lizhongc.com/

asm-x86's People

Contributors

endlesscheng av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.